The Role
You'll join a multidisciplinary engineering team responsible for taking machine learning models from experimentation through to production.
This is a hands-on software engineering role where you'll build the services, APIs and tooling that power the entire machine learning life cycle-from model training and deployment through to monitoring, automation and continuous improvement.
Working closely with Applied Scientists, you'll transform research prototypes into robust, maintainable production systems capable of operating reliably at scale.
What You'll Be Doing
- Build and maintain Python applications that support the full machine learning life cycle
- Develop APIs and services for model training, inference and evaluation
- Deploy, version and manage machine learning models across production environments
- Design monitoring and observability for production ML systems
- Build automated workflows for model retraining, testing and deployment
- Collaborate with Applied Scientists to productionise new machine learning models
- Improve scalability, reliability and performance through automation and engineering best practice
- Contribute to the design and evolution of the company's machine learning architecture
